I asked for QtWebKit in Otter to be kept when QtWebEngine was introduced, because it was the only fully featured browser that really worked on macppc. Since the last QtWebKit update, it was crashing when running javascript. And now the rust-powered spidermonkey78 is in its chain of dependencies, so it's not built anymore on macppc anyway. OK rsadoswki@, maintainer timeout
43 lines
1011 B
Makefile
43 lines
1011 B
Makefile
# $OpenBSD: Makefile,v 1.34 2020/11/01 23:05:14 cwen Exp $
|
|
|
|
COMMENT = browser aiming to recreate classic Opera (12.x) UI using Qt5
|
|
|
|
DISTNAME = otter-browser-1.0.01
|
|
REVISION = 2
|
|
|
|
CATEGORIES = www
|
|
|
|
HOMEPAGE = https://otter-browser.org/
|
|
|
|
MAINTAINER = Adam Wolk <awolk@openbsd.org>
|
|
|
|
MASTER_SITES = ${MASTER_SITE_SOURCEFORGE:=otter-browser/}
|
|
EXTRACT_SUFX = .tar.bz2
|
|
|
|
# GPLv3+
|
|
PERMIT_PACKAGE = Yes
|
|
|
|
WANTLIB += ${COMPILER_LIBCXX}
|
|
WANTLIB += Qt5Core Qt5DBus Qt5Gui Qt5Multimedia Qt5Network Qt5Positioning
|
|
WANTLIB += Qt5PrintSupport Qt5Qml Qt5Quick Qt5Svg Qt5WebChannel
|
|
WANTLIB += Qt5WebEngineCore Qt5WebEngineWidgets Qt5Widgets Qt5XmlPatterns
|
|
WANTLIB += c hunspell-1.7 m
|
|
|
|
MODULES = devel/cmake x11/qt5
|
|
|
|
RUN_DEPENDS = devel/desktop-file-utils x11/gtk+3,-guic
|
|
|
|
LIB_DEPENDS = textproc/hunspell \
|
|
x11/qt5/qtdeclarative \
|
|
x11/qt5/qtmultimedia \
|
|
x11/qt5/qtsvg \
|
|
x11/qt5/qtwebengine \
|
|
x11/qt5/qtxmlpatterns
|
|
|
|
CONFIGURE_ARGS += -DENABLE_QTWEBENGINE=ON \
|
|
-DENABLE_QTWEBKIT=OFF
|
|
|
|
NO_TEST = Yes
|
|
|
|
.include <bsd.port.mk>
|